Summary

Martin Johnson Heade's prolific oeuvre ranges from American coastal marshes to the lush tropical splendour of South and Central American landscapes, birds and flowers. This illustrated volume is the catalogue for a major retrospective of Heade's work, opening at the Museum of Fine Arts, Boston.

Theodore E. Stebbins, Jr., is curator of American art and Virginia Anderson is assistant curator of American art, both at the Harvard University Art Museums. Kimberly Orcutt is associate curator of American art at the New-York Historical Society.
